Extremely nice 86 GN with Duttweiler Twin Turbo V8
Car was stripped to the metal and repainted. Car had zero rust or damage.
Car built by Duttweiler and has approximately 2000 miles since built and about 35 passes at 1/8 and 1/4 mile tracks, combined.
I have made only 3 passes on the car. The Torque Converter, has a stock stall and at idle car will drive.. My passes consisted of leaving at 2000 RPM with 5 lbs boost and ran 12 lbs boost during run. Car ran a 10.3 with a 1.9 60ft and 139.5 MPH. The car has too low a gear ratio (3.9) & with a short tire hit the computer rev limiter at 3/4 track. Top Speed at 7000 RPM is 139.5.
With a 3.4 or 3.3 Ratio car will run mid 9's on 12 LBS boost.
The lowest I can turn down the boost is 12 lbs using a knob on the center console.
Car has manual steering, manual brakes and stops easily from 139 MPH.
According to Dyno Sheet, 12 lbs boost is 802 HP and 702 lbs TQ at the crank.
Dyno Sheet says 17LBs boost makes 1035HP, 780 LBs TQ with HP still climbing.
Engine made 1450 HP on Duttweilers Dyno at Crank.I don't know the boost.

This was Pat Fiero's old car and I remember Pat would say he couldn't keep the car off the rev limiter. It turns out the problem was the 3.9 rear gears and the sort tire. At 3/4 track the engine hits the Motec Rev Limit of 7000 and that was what he was hitting also.
12 lbs is all I have used on pump gas and its as fast as I care to run.
